NAME


gfm - a program to manipulate files for TI's handhelds

SYNOPSYS


gfm [-h / --help] [-v / --version] filename

DESCRIPTION


The gfm program allows you to group/ungroup files as well as add/remove/rename entries.

OPTIONS


The command line of gfm can be used for loading files.

gfm accepts the following options:

-h, --help
Display a list of all command line options.

-v, --version
Output the version info.
